Location




Hemsworth is a bustling market town with excellent transport links. The practice is just a short walk from the bus station, offering routes across Barnsley, Wakefield, Pontefract, and Doncaster. With the M1 and A1 close by, we're easily connected to the cities of Leeds, Sheffield, and even Manchester--perfect if you enjoy the energy of city life.
